My python script containing import matplotlib.pyplot as plt
was not working and one of my classmate suggested to remove one of the python packages. (My dell ubuntu 12.04 desktop has two python programme 2.7 and 3) So, I run the command sudo apt-get remove python
. Now my terminal and unity launcher is missing. How can I recover everything without reinstalling? I can login in the tty

You have to reinstall Terminal and Unity.
You also need to install Python again.
Login to tty
and type this command:
sudo apt-get install --reinstall ubuntu-desktop gnome-terminal && sudo apt-get install python
(or whatever is it's name)
